zl程序教程

您现在的位置是:首页 >  大数据

当前栏目

提高查询性能聪明人用MSSQL:提高查询性能的妙招(在mssql中)

性能 mssql 查询 提高 聪明人
2023-06-13 09:17:57 时间

Microsoft SQL Server (MSSQL) 是一个非常受欢迎的数据库服务器应用程序,可以满足用户的各种需求。不仅如此,它还可以帮助用户提高查询性能。下面是五个简单易行但十分有效的提高MSSQL查询性能的方法:

1、对于独立的查询语句,最好只能使用有索引功能的精简查询来分包检索。尽量避免使用IN、NOT IN等复杂查询,以加快查询速度。例如:

SELECT * FROM table WHERE id IN (1, 2, 3)

// 可替换为

SELECT * FROM table WHERE id=1 or id=2 or id=3

2、把常用的表及表联接拆分为两个,并在每个表都创建联接所需的索引。这有助于加快联接表查询的速度。

3、拆分复杂查询为多个简单查询,并将拆分的查询结果一次性合并。

4、使用视图代替复杂的查询语句,将多个表的结构合并进一个虚拟表,可以减轻复杂查询的压力。

5、尽量不要使用“*”通配符,应该指定需要获取的列名,以提高查询速度。

以上,就是如何用MSSQL提高查询性能的5个有效的小妙招。此外,还可以考虑使用一些高级的技术,如存储过程与触发器,来优化数据检索的性能。总的来说,MSSQL是一项强大的数据库技术,可以帮助用户高效地提供数据和查询信息,从而改善用户体验。


我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题

本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 提高查询性能聪明人用MSSQL:提高查询性能的妙招(在mssql中)